    You will be surprised, dear Margaret, to have a letter from me here instead of from Touraine. We fully intended to go directly from the Dolomites and Venice to Milan and on to Tours, stopping a day or two in Paris en route, but Miss Cassandra begged for a few days on Lake Como, as in all her travels by sea and shore she has never seen the Italian lakes. We changed our itinerary simply to be obliging, but Walter and I have had no reason to regret the change for one minute. Beautiful as you and I found this region in June, I must admit that its August charms are more entrancing and pervasive. Instead of the clear blues, greens and purples of June, the light haze that veils the mountain tops brings out the same indescribable opalescent shades of heliotrope, azure and rose that we thought belonged exclusively to the Dolomites. However, these mountains are first cousins, once or twice removed, to the Eastern Italian and Austrian Alps and have a good right to a family likeness. There is something almost intoxicating in the ethereal beauty of this lake, something that goes to one's head like wine. I don't wonder that poets and artists rave about its charms, ofwhich not the least is its infinite variety. The scene changes so quickly. The glow of color fades, a cloud obscures the sun, the blue and purple turn to gray in an instant, and we descend from a hillside garden, where gay flowers gain added brilliancy from the sun, to a cypressbordered path where the grateful shade is so dense that we walk in twilight and listen to the liquid note of the nightingale, or the blackcap, whose song is sometimes mistaken for that of his more distinguished neighbor.

    "The Ruins" is a work by Constantin-François Volney, a French philosopher and historian. The full title of the book is "The Ruins, or, Meditation on the Revolutions of Empires and the Law of Nature." It was first published in 1791.In "The Ruins," Volney explores the historical and philosophical implications of the rise and fall of empires. The work delves into the causes of societal decay and the cyclical nature of civilizations. Volney draws on his observations during travels in the Middle East, including visits to ancient ruins, to support his reflections on the fate of empires.The book is considered a significant work of Enlightenment thinking and has influenced discussions on history, politics, and philosophy. Volney's reflections on the patterns of human societies have contributed to the understanding of the rise and decline of civilizations.For readers interested in Enlightenment philosophy, the history of ideas, and reflections on the fate of empires, "The Ruins" by C. F. Volney provides a thought-provoking exploration of these themes.

Yauco, the place selected by General Miles as a rendezvous for the troops of the Independent Regular Brigade, is a town of about 15,000 inhabitants, and some six miles distant from Guanica. It is connected both by rail and wagon-road with Ponce, the largest city on the island, and is noted for its Spanish proclivities, fine climate, excellent running water, and setting of mountains¿luxuriantly green throughout the year.

    " L'histoire en France reste volontiers dans les limites de nos frontières, et quand elle les franchit, ce n'est en général que pour faire campagne à la suite de nos armées. Nos plus belles colonies, l'Inde, le Canada, la Louisiane, Haïti, occupent à peine quelques pages dans les volumineuses compilations de nos annalistes, et tout ce qui touche à cette France d'outre-mer, perdue sans retour, se borne à quelques dates, à quelques noms et à de stériles regrets. Non contents d'être oublieux, nous nous montrons encore injustes envers nous-mêmes, et nous calomnions notre pays en disant qu'il n'a ni le génie des voyages, ni le génie des découvertes, ni le génie de la colonisation. C'est là chez nous une opinion profondément enracinée dans un grand nombre d'esprits, mais, très heureusement, aussi fausse qu'elle est populaire, car il est à remarquer que, sauf les questions d'honneur et de gloire militaire, nous sommes toujours prêts, dans les grandes choses, à nous déprécier et dans les bagatelles à exagérer notre valeur. Qu'on examine en effet notre histoire, et l'on verra combien les reproches dont nous venons de parler sont peu fondés..."

    " On a dit avec raison que les langues, comme les peuples, ont leur âge d'or, leur âge d'argent, leur âge d'airain et leur âge de fer : il y a un idiome qui plus qu'aucun autre justifie cette remarque, c'est la langue latine. Elle règne d'abord avec les Romains sur le monde antique ; elle reste durant de longs siècles, dans la barbarie même du moyen âge, la langue officielle du gouvernement, de la religion, de la science, de la poésie; elle unit, comme un lien fraternel, les nations chrétiennes : c'est là son âge d'argent. Puis cet idiome se retire peu à peu devant les langues nouvelles, dont quelques-unes sont tout à la fois ses rivales et ses filles. Au moment même où la renaissance semble vouloir le ramener à sa pureté primitive, les réformés le bannissent de leurs temples, les gouvernements de leur diplomatie et de leurs lois. C'est l'âge de fer qui commence pour la langue latine. La science elle-même, en se vulgarisant, la chasse de ses livres, la poésie remplace par la rime ses dactyles et ses spondées, et seul le catholicisme, dans son immobilité surhumaine, lui garde toujours au fond du sanctuaire un inviolable asile..."
